504 Course Information
Biomolecular Chemistry 504
is a two-credit biochemistry course including lab and discussions on
basic principles of human biochemistry with an emphasis on modern biochemical
techniques used professionally in research, clinical, and biotechnology
laboratories.
Labs include exercises in protein purification and characterization,
enzymology, DNA cloning, PCR analysis and immunochemistry. This laboratory
course requires Biomolecular Chemistry 503 or other acceptable biochemistry
course taken previously or concurrently. This course is offered in the
spring and summer semesters. If you are currently enrolled in the Spring
